Recent research shows that cutting-edge AI agents can complete multiple scientific research and engineering tasks, but they are not yet able to consistently produce original papers that can be accepted by top AI conferences.

A study involving Princeton University, the UK AI Security Institute, Stanford University, and the University of Toronto shows that while current cutting-edge AI agents can independently complete many engineering tasks in the research process, they are still significantly lacking in making original scientific contributions and struggle to produce papers that can be accepted by top machine learning conferences.

Complete the entire process within six days

The research, published Wednesday and titled "Can AI agents conduct open AI research?", involved a team that instead of using standard tests with pre-defined answers. Instead, they presented the AI with the core questions from two unpublished NeurIPS 2026 papers to avoid the system finding ready-made answers directly from training data or networks.

Researchers provided each AI agent with six days, along with thousands of dollars in API credits, GPU resources, internet access, and virtual machine environments, requiring them to independently produce papers that met the standards for submission to academic conferences.

The papers were written, but all were rejected.

The results showed that these systems completed a significant amount of research work, including literature retrieval, software debugging, experiment running, GPU resource management, and generating complete papers without human intervention. However, after review by the original research authors, both AI-generated papers failed to pass the review.

The research team believes that this type of test reflects AI's scientific reasoning ability better than traditional benchmarks because it deals with open-ended research questions rather than well-defined, fixed tasks. The reviewers all agree on one point: the system can complete the engineering steps, but it still cannot offer sufficiently novel research contributions to justify publication in top-tier conferences.

Original scientific research remains a weakness

The study also summarized five recurring failure patterns, which it believes are the main reasons why AI papers fail to meet publishable standards. The original abstract did not elaborate on the specifics of these five problems, but the overall conclusion is clear: AI can handle many execution tasks in the research process, but it still struggles to produce truly original scientific research.

The authors also noted that this test only covered two research projects, resulting in a small sample size, and that the AI-generated papers were reviewed by the original researchers, which introduced certain limitations. However, they still believe the results are sufficient to demonstrate that cutting-edge AI agents are rapidly taking over the engineering aspects of scientific research, but there is still a significant gap between them and independently completing original research.

Additional information:Before and after the release of this study, the academic community has been continuously monitoring the anomalous behavior of autonomous AI agents. In May, researchers from the University of California, Riverside, Microsoft, and Nvidia reported that AI agents often made dangerous or irrational actions when performing objectives. OpenAI also disclosed this month that one of its cutting-edge AI agents attempted to cheat in a cybersecurity benchmark test, bypassed restrictions to access Hugging Face, and subsequently accessed four other online services.
